Tragedy struck in Sibalom, Antique, as a woman lost her life after sustaining over 30 stab wounds during a brutal altercation with her live-in partner. The victim was identified as Rena Jane, 28 years old, from Barangay Maasin, Sibalom, Antique, while the suspect was identified as Elizarde Arnaiz, 38 years old, from Barangay Banban, Lawaan, Antique. Around 12:45 AM on July 24, 2023, in Barangay San Juan, Sibalom, Antique, the horrifying incident unfolded. According to PMAJ Renato Monreal, head of the Sibalom, Antique Municipal Police Station, jealousy was the motive behind the heinous crime.
The suspect allegedly confessed to the police that he caught his live-in partner chatting with another man, igniting a violent confrontation. Tragically, the murder occurred in the presence of their own five-year-old son, who witnessed the horrendous act. Fleeing the scene on a motorcycle, the suspect took their five-year-old child with him, leaving behind a scene of devastation. Overwhelmed with guilt, the suspect sought refuge and confessed to the barangay captain in a village in Antique province on July 25, 2023. On the same day, the Sibalom, Antique MPS filed a murder case against the suspect, according to PMAJ Monreal.
The suspect’s means of livelihood was selling fish. The couple’s child is now under the care of the victim’s relatives, and counseling will be provided to help him cope with the traumatic experience of witnessing his mother’s murder.
